Effects of Fermented Banana Stem as Corn Substitutes on Performance and Protein Utilization in Growing-Finishing Pigs

Abstract

The objective of this study was to test banana stem silage as a substitute for corn on the performance and protein utilization rate of Duroc crosses pigs in the rearing phase. A total of 12 Duroc crosses pigs in the rearing phase with an average initial weight of 51.25 kg (KV = 7.02%). A completely randomized design (CRD) with 4 treatments and 3 replicates was used in this study. The treatments were T0: ration without a mixture of fermented banana stems (FBS), T1: ration with 5% FBS instead of cornmeal, T2: ration with 10% FBS instead of cornmeal, and T3: ration with 15% FBS instead of cornmeal. The variables measured were ration consumption, daily weight gain, ration utilization and protein utilization efficiency. The results showed that the use of FBS up to 15% (instead of 40% corn) had no effect on ration consumption, daily weight gain, ration utilization and protein utilization efficiency. Therefore, it can be concluded that banana stems can be used at 15% in the ration of Duroc crosses pigs in the rearing phase as a substitute for corn meal.
